U-shaped design allows you to open windows while unit is installed. Substantial cooling capacity. Inverter compressor minimizes swings in temperature. Installation is more complicated than other window A/Cs. Despite its large size, the Midea U-Shaped MAW12V1QWT is very well-suited for use in small rooms.
ULTRA QUIET - The U-shape design of Midea U Smart Inverter AC uses your window to block noise outside. The highly-efficient inverter system warrants ultra-low noise and vibration, 10x quieter than traditional units with operation as low as 32 dBA.Control Type: Electronic. Clean Filter Indicator Light: Yes. Rated Cooling Amps (AHAM): 12.17.
